We have only ever stayed at deluxe resorts, but have never, ever had problems keeping a room cool, and that's coming from a person who hates being warm, especially at night. Last August when we checked into our room at AKL it was cold enough to store meat.

The only minor problems we have is when we try to increase the temperature by too many degrees at a time, the heat kicks on. It happened once at BWI, the heat went on and I actually thought something was burning. The next time it happened at AKL, I remembered it happening before, therefore only bumping the thermostat a degree at a time.

I've stayed at Pop, All Star Sports, POFQ, CBR, BC and BWI and have never had a problem keeping the room nice and cold.
 
Last trip at Pop, we discovered that the AC was set at a certain temp. Just called maintenance, and they came and lowered it. So any resort can do that for you!

I have a medically fragile child, so also sometimes get a VIP cleaning (next time need to - last trip didn't) and it makes a difference!

Just call if it's too warm; they will lower it for you!
